Research Areas

CRISPR-Cas immunity system; Genome-editing technology; Cryo-EM; Structural Biology; Biochemistry

Research Interests

The Hu lab is interested in fundamental molecular mechanisms of biological macro-molecules in organisms. We focus on elucidating the molecular and cellular mechanisms that control the assembly, regulation, and therapeutic application of supramolecular complexes in immunity systems. Our current research focuses on CRISPR-Cas systems which are adaptive immunity systems in procaryotes to defeat viruses. Our ongoing projects include but not limited to the followings:

 

1) Identification of novel CRISPR-Cas systems.

2) High-resolution mechanism study of supermolecule complexes.

3) Development and application of new genome-editing tools.

4) Diagnostic platform innovation based on CRISPR-Cas systems.

5) Therapeutic intervention based on gene-editing and RNA technologies.

6) Real-time reporter/imaging system exploring in cells.

7) Immunity beyond CRISPR.

Selected Publications

  1. Chunyi Hu*, Sam P. B. van Beljouw*, Ki Hyun Nam, Gabriel Schuler, Fran Ding, Yanru Cui, Alicia Rodríguez-Molina, Anna C Haagsma, Menno Valk, Martin Pabst, Stan J.J. Brouns‡, Ailong Ke‡. CRISPR Craspase is an RNA-guided, RNA-activated protease. Science. 2022. (10.1126/science.add5064)

  2. Chunyi Hu*, Cristóbal Almendros*, Ki Hyun Nam, Ana Rita Costa, Jochem NA Vink, Anna C Haagsma, Saket R Bagde, Stan JJ Brouns‡, Ailong Ke‡. Mechanism for Cas4-assisted directional spacer acquisition in CRISPR–Cas. Nature. 598, pages515–520 (2021)

  3. ​Gabriel Schuler*, Chunyi Hu* (co-first author), Ailong Ke. Structural basis for RNA-guided DNA cleavage by IscB-ωRNA and the evolutionary connection with Cas9-crRNA-tracrRNA. Science. 2022. DOI: 0.1126/science.abq7220

  4. Chunyi Hu, Dongchun Ni, Ki Hyun Nam, Sonali Majumdar, Justin McLean, Henning Stahlberg, Michael P Terns, Ailong Ke. Allosteric control of Type I-A CRISPR-Cas3 complexes and establishment as effective nucleic acid detection and human genome editing tools, Molecular Cell, 2022 10.1016/j.molcel.2022.06.007

  5. Chunyi Hu*, Rekha Rai*, Chenhui Huang, Cayla Broton, Juanjuan Long, Ying Xu, Jing Xue, Ming Lei‡, Sandy Chang‡, Yong Chen‡. (2017) Structural and functional analyses of the mammalian TIN2-TPP1-TRF2 telomeric complex. Cell research, 27, 1485-1502.

  6. Chunyi Hu*, Haruna Inoue*, Wenqi Sun*, Yumiko Takeshita, Yaoguang Huang, Ying Xu, Junko Kanoh‡, Yong Chen‡. (2019) Structural insights into chromosome attachment to the nuclear envelope by an inner nuclear membrane protein Bqt4 in fission yeast. Nucleic acids research, 47, 1573-1584.
